On Tue, Jan 13, 2015 at 12:12:41PM +0000, Peter Maydell wrote:
> On 13 January 2015 at 12:04, Christoffer Dall
> <christoffer.dall@linaro.org> wrote:
> > Additionally, I haven't been able to think of a reasonable guest
> > scenario where this breaks.  Once the guest turns on its MMU it should
> > deal with the necessary icache invalidation itself (I think), so we're
> > really talking about situations where the stage-1 MMU is off, and I
> > gather that mostly you'll be seeing a single core doing any heavy
> > lifting and then secondary cores basically coming up, only seeing valid
> > entries in the icache, and doing the necessary invalidat+turn on mmu
> > stuff.
> 
> The trouble with that is that as the secondary comes up, before it
> turns on its icache its VA->PA mapping is the identity map; whereas
> the primary vCPU's VA->PA mapping is "whatever the guest kernel's
> usual mapping is". If the kernel has some mapping other than identity
> for the VA which is wherever the secondary-CPU-startup-to-MMU-enable
> code lives (which seems quite likely), then you have potential problems.
> 
Wouldn't a guest (and I believe Linux does this) reserve ASID 0 for
additional cores and use ASID 1+++ for itself?

Or does the potential hits in the icache for a stage-1 turned-off MMU
hit on all ASIDs ?
